        • This course, entitled “Communication and Expression Techniques (in French)”, is primarily intended for first-year Bachelor’s degree students (common core SNV), as well as practitioners specializing in TEC. It provides a synthesis of essential theoretical and practical knowledge in TEC, with a focus on applications in various situations.

          This course complies with the academic programs of higher education institutions and is designed to equip future communicators with the necessary skills to address challenges related to TEC. The objective is to develop a deep understanding of TEC processes. The course is structured around four key chapters, namely:

          1. Scientific Terminology
          2. Study and Text Comprehension
          3. Written and Oral Expression Techniques (reports, summaries, use of modern communication tools)
          4. Expression and Communication in a Group. Study of Selected Texts (observe, analyze, summarize, written expression)

          Tutorials (Practical Work):
          Provision of exercises related to the most important language aspects.

          Assessment Method:
          Continuous assessment and a semester examination.

          It is essential to clearly understand the distinction between expression and communication. Expression refers to the way an idea is formulated, while communication focuses on the process of exchanging information. This distinction is crucial, as good expression does not necessarily guarantee successful communication if the message is not properly received or understood.
